Nettet11. apr. 2024 · Before the pandemic, the world was already facing an education crisis. Last year, 53% of 10-year-old children in low- and middle-income countries either had failed to learn to read with comprehension or were out of school. COVID-19 has exacerbated learning gaps further, taking 1.6 billion students out of school at its peak. Nettetfor 1 dag siden · Fifty-four percent of English learners at this school are reading and writing at grade level by third grade, according to their scores on Smarter Balanced, the state’s standardized test. That’s more than four times the average in California – only 12.5% of English learners in third grade statewide met or exceeded the standard in …
